"was gladed" vs "was glad"

The correct phrase is "was glad." The phrase "was gladed" is incorrect and not used in English.

Last Updated: March 25, 2024

was gladed

This phrase is incorrect and not used in English.

was glad

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

This phrase is used to express past feelings of happiness or satisfaction.

Examples:

  • I was glad to see you.
  • She was glad that the project was successful.
  • He was glad he made the decision.
  • We were glad to help.
  • They were glad to hear the news.
